What You’ll Do on the Program
Hospitality MIT Track (Rooms Division)
- Rotate through core guest service roles including Front Desk, Concierge, and PBX
- Learn how to deliver standout hospitality in a relaxed luxury setting
- Pay: $15 per hour
- Schedule: Minimum of 32 hours per week
Culinary Arts MIT Trainee
- Train across all areas of the kitchen, from preparation to service and leadership
- Get exposure to culinary operations while building your management potential
- Pay: Fully sponsored program (only a $250 application fee + $30 bank transfer fee required)
- Schedule: Minimum of 32 hours per week
Both programs include career coaching, real-world training, and cultural exchange outings to places like Los Angeles and Disneyland.

Housing
- Shared co-ed housing is provided free of charge for the duration of your program
- Accommodation includes furnished apartments or homes with WiFi
- Expect to share a room with fellow program participants and live just minutes from work and the beach
